Slot Number
12346868
Finalized
Epoch Number
Status
proposed
Age
185 days 6 hrs ago (Aug-12-2025 08:13:59 AM +UTC)

BlockRoot Hash
0x240a9afd7f8c1386fffc2967263f5638ebfee3c684c6bb4b4054c95fa1c9cdc7
State Root
0xa4d4c93de26de9c6d00194846c7f83417253ca1a4f5a7ce0db19bf680465affc

Randao Reveal
0xada192039a735459df0e535e9ded0ec8074451f4c3f6cd633f097df4c7e3ba28fb7a84fd43dbea581586c94f521d5eeb0724d409b6d9723194c4c748378d1bf78fa486bfe385c5f9c1664e6926204c71c66953e56ec319ca928e15ac153b7d7f

Graffiti
0x0000000000000000000000000000000000000000000000000000000000000000

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xaa3d937cf09412bc731afb2caeadcc0ea3089f9508d82d3191453277a7ff11ebc1eb169e7a7641ab659ac672161137eb04c76d4188ed3350a1c95645ae120591a7251dadefc96b24f550c6e9b2e3be9086eaf942fd39b7c2e59c057f1a5b62eb

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ators